Touring cycling routes around Zaleszany navigate a diverse landscape characterized by the Vistula River Valley, offering both flat riverside paths and areas with extensive orchards. The region features rolling hills and unique loess gorges, providing varied topographical experiences. Cyclists can explore agricultural scenery alongside natural features like the Pepper Mountains. The area provides a network of routes suitable for different fitness levels.

The Monument of Freedom on Freedom Square in Nisko is a tall, concrete obelisk erected in 1970 as the site of major patriotic ceremonies. It is adorned with a plaque inscribed with "To the daughters and sons of the Nisko land who fell for the Homeland", commemorating all local heroes of the fight for independence.

There are over 20 touring cycling routes in the Zaleszany area, catering to various skill levels. You'll find a mix of easy, moderate, and a few more challenging options.
The region offers diverse terrain. You'll encounter flat riverside paths along the Vistula River Valley, areas with extensive orchards, and rolling hills. Some routes also feature unique loess gorges, providing varied topographical experiences.
Yes, Zaleszany offers several easy routes. For instance, the Oczko Lake – Nadsańskie Meadows loop from Turbia is an easy 18.8-mile (30.2 km) trail through scenic riverside areas. Another easy option is the Horodyński Family Manor – Footbridge loop from Zbydniów, which is 19.2 miles (30.9 km) long.
Many routes connect to the historic city of Sandomierz, where you can explore the well-preserved Sandomierz Market Square, the Royal Castle in Sandomierz, and the 14th-century Opatowska Gate. The Sandomierz Vineyard is also a unique highlight in the area.
Absolutely. The Royal Castle in Sandomierz – Zamkowe in Sandomierz loop from gmina Zaleszany is a popular 38.1-mile (61.4 km) route that connects to the historic city. Another excellent option is the Royal Castle in Sandomierz – Sandomierz Market Square loop from gmina Zaleszany, a 29.5-mile (47.4 km) path leading through the Vistula River valley and past Sandomierz's medieval urban layout.
The region's picturesque countryside, fields, and vineyards are best enjoyed during the warmer months, typically from spring through early autumn. This period offers pleasant weather for exploring the Vistula River valley and historical sites.
The touring cycling routes around Zaleszany are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.7 stars from over 240 reviews. Cyclists often praise the varied terrain, the scenic views of the Vistula River, and the opportunities to visit historical Sandomierz.
Yes, Zaleszany's location provides potential access to routes along or with views of the Vistula River. The Royal Castle in Sandomierz – Sandomierz Market Square loop from gmina Zaleszany, for example, leads directly through the Vistula River valley.
While most routes are easy to moderate, the diverse terrain including rolling hills and loess gorges means some paths will offer more of a challenge. There is at least one route classified as difficult, providing options for experienced touring cyclists seeking a greater physical test.
Yes, both Zaleszany and especially the nearby historic city of Sandomierz offer various amenities. Sandomierz, being a major tourist draw, has numerous cafes, pubs, and accommodation options that cater to visitors, including cyclists looking for a break or an overnight stay.
Many of the touring cycling routes around Zaleszany are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location. Examples include the Royal Castle in Sandomierz – Zamkowe in Sandomierz loop and the Oczko Lake – Nadsańskie Meadows loop.
One of the longer routes is the Royal Castle in Sandomierz – Zamkowe in Sandomierz loop from gmina Zaleszany, which spans 38.1 miles (61.4 km) and takes approximately 3 hours and 29 minutes to complete.
